    Some airlines are taking 3 months or more to issue refunds, and Lastminute will want the airline refund before they transfer it to you. 

    Virgin Atlantic are now at 120 days or something daft!
    That's completely irrelevant legally. If lastminute are the Organiser they are responsible for paying you back - getting the money from The Provider is their problem not yours.
